Transaction 2eca065a8229b83d5b3a5bae02186522d41ee0a08aa1fb261f33feecb5a23926
2 Input
2 Outputs
- 2eca065a8229b83d5b3a5bae02186522d41ee0a08aa1fb261f33feecb5a23926:0
- 2eca065a8229b83d5b3a5bae02186522d41ee0a08aa1fb261f33feecb5a23926:1
value 29330000
address 1BshuWb3yEFvXyTzfdnCXoE2MFH3iKPg1C
value 2970417
address 14wXrm49HxggbdQ6RGfWY8qghGEWhLA28K